Arsenal contacts Dortmund chief scout as Newcastle and Tottenham show interest
Yahoo Sports • 1 min read • Latest: Aug 18, 2026, 11:54 AM
Last updated Aug 18, 2026

Arsenal has made contact with Borussia Dortmund chief scout Sebastian Krug, as reported by Sky Germany. The Gunners are interested in the 43-year-old, who has been instrumental in Dortmund’s recent recruitment. Newcastle United and Tottenham Hotspur are also reportedly looking into Krug, who helped facilitate high-profile signings like Erling Haaland and Jude Bellingham. Krug, now in his role since 2022, may face increased competition for his services this summer.
